MySQL是一種流行的開源DBMS,被廣泛用于網站和應用程序的數據存儲和管理。默認情況下,MySQL服務器以安全模式運行,該模式有許多安全限制和限制。如果您需要執行某些操作,例如更改數據庫的系統變量,您需要關閉MySQL的安全模式。
#關閉MySQL的安全模式 $ mysql -u root -p Enter password: MySQL>SET SQL_MODE=' '; MySQL>FLUSH PRIVILEGES; MySQL>exit
您可以在啟動MySQL時使用以下命令,關閉MySQL的安全模式。
#修改MySQL的配置文件,以關閉安全模式 $ sudo vi /etc/my.cnf #添加以下行到文件的底部 [mysqld] sql-mode="" #保存并關閉my.cnf文件 $ sudo systemctl restart mysqld
請注意,關閉MySQL的安全模式可能會使您的系統和數據庫容易受到惡意攻擊。因此,您應該在必要時關閉安全模式,并確保采取其他安全措施來保護您的數據。